Not sure who to contact for forum suggestions, or if we should have a forum dedicated to... suggestions.

For example, I'd like to know if it would be feasible to have a button, when shopping, that would allow you to copy to clipboard your basket items into a forum-friendly embedded object (or better, tags and BBcode), with images, links, and prices. That would save a bit of time having to screen-capture your basket, edit, dump into imageshack, then back into your post :) Plus, would give the opportunity to actually hot-link to the items, and so on.
